Background
Marine Corps Systems Command (MARCORSYSCOM) has fielded a host of tactical systems (Systems) that have become essential to modern warfighting and the full range of military operations. As many Systems are fielded without complete, thorough, accessible, or continuous training plans, Marine Corps Tactical Systems Support Activity (MCTSSA) has provided support to the warfighter to fill the gap in technical expertise and, ultimately, ensure that they remain mission capable. Born from a communications background, MCTSSA primarily focuses its support on fielded command, control, computer, communications, and intelligence (C4I) systems. The effective results of MCTSSA’s support mission have led many MARCORSYSCOM programs of record to reduce reliance on program-specific Field Service Representatives (FSRs) and support their respective systems and applications through MCTSSA. In response to these growing requirements, MCTSSA established the Warfighter Support Division (WSD) to serve as the main effort for all systems support to the fleet Marine forces (FMF)—Marine, Joint, coalition, and other US agencies. WSD provides remote (secure and unsecure phone, email, chat) and on-site tactical systems support covering a variety of system issues, including but not limited to: systems troubleshooting and issue resolution, setup and configuration, information and knowledge management, configuration management, software and documentation distribution, maintenance procedures, operations, network analysis and diagnostics,
engineering,
and over-the-shoulder training,
system/equipment fielding support,
